A recent example comes from Chita State Medical Academy (ChSMA), where students participated in a high-impact medical hackathon combining IT + Medicine.
🚀 IT + Medicine: A New Era in Medical Education
At a joint hackathon organized with Sberbank and Transbaikal State University, interdisciplinary teams of medical and IT students worked on solving real clinical problems.
The primary challenge:
Develop an AI-based system capable of diagnosing hip dysplasia using X-ray imaging.

🧠 Project Outcome: AI-Based Diagnosis System
Within just one week, participating teams successfully developed intelligent diagnostic models. These systems were evaluated based on:
- Algorithm accuracy
- Clinical applicability
- Scalability potential
- Real-world implementation feasibility

🏆 Hackathon Winners & Achievements
- 🥇 1st Place: Team from Transbaikal State University + ChSMA student
- 🥈 2nd Place: Teams from Novosibirsk & Altai universities
- 🥉 3rd Place: Joint team including ChSMA medical students
One of the standout projects focused on assisting radiologists by reducing diagnostic complexity and improving speed using AI.
